Languages Of Sweden
Swedish Language, Swedish is the official language of Sweden and is spoken by the vast majority of the 10.23 million inhabitants of the country. It is a North Germanic languages, North Germanic language and quite similar to its sister Scandinavian languages, Danish language, Danish and Norwegian language, Norwegian, with which it maintains partial mutual intelligibility and forms a Dialect continuum#North Germanic continuum, dialect continuum. A number of regional Swedish dialects are spoken across the country. In total, more than 200 languages are estimated to be spoken across the country, including regional languages, indigenous Sámi languages, and immigrant languages. In 2009, the Riksdag passed a national language law recognizing Swedish as the ''main'' and ''common'' language of society, as well as the official language for "international contexts".
